Report of Panel 3: Management Science in the Procurement Cycle, 1968 DoD Contract Management Conference, IMPACT 73, Held in Dallas, Texas

This panel was joined to study the varied tools and techniques that have been developed in the field of management science. They reviewed the efforts made by CAS, and other elements of DoD, to apply these techniques, and they evaluated the success of those applications. Their purpose was to consider the potential uses of the more recent and advanced tools and techniques and to set forth, in a general way, new concepts for the development of scientific methods at all levels of CAS management.

Report of Panel: Manpower, 1968 DoD Contract Management Conference, IMPACT 73, Held in Dallas, Texas

The panel conducted a detailed study of the overall field of personnel management within CAS. They reviewed past developments, considered the implications of the present situation, and then announced their coordinated decisions as to the best courses of action by which CAS might strengthen manpower resources in the future. The report treats the subject under five divisions as follows: I. Requirements Planning II. Recruitment III. Career Development and Training IV. Interface Between Personnel and Activity Managers V. Development of Key Procurement Officers (Military).

Report of Panel 14: Pricing, 1968 DoD Management Conference, IMPACT 73, Held in Dallas, Texas

The function of procurement pricing is an integral part of the procurement process and is carried out by all elements of the DoD, either as part of other procurement functions or as an identifiable organizational element. It is accomplished in both purchasing and contract administration services (CAS) activities. When accomplished at the purchasing activity, its primary purpose is to assist the procuring contracting officer (PCO) in determining that prices being paid by the government for supplies and services are fair and reasonable. When accomplished by the contract administration activity, it also serves the same purpose when the administrative contracting officer (ACO) has been assigned final pricing responsibility (such as for spare parts pricing). In addition, the CAS pricing function also includes the review and evaluation of contractor proposals to be negotiated by the PCO, determination of reasonableness of costs claimed under cost-type contracts, and contractor management systems reviews. The objectives of Panel 14 were to examine the CAS pricing function and major problems, trends, and goals which affect pricing performance, and to recommend any changes considered necessary for improvement.

Report of Panel 7: The Cas Computer Communication Network, 1968 DoD Contract Management Conference, IMPACT 73, Held in Dallas, Texas

"The CAS Computer-Communication Network," had the responsibility of reviewing the CAS computer communications network from the standpoint of possible problems that could delay MILSCAP implementation. The Panel was also charged with developing objectives that should be pursed via MILSCAP through at least 1973. Panel 7 identified twenty areas where an expansion of MILSCAP might be profitable. These are discussed thoroughly and recommendations made to further the CAS communication network.
